I never have understood the big deal Christians make over the Christmas tree when it was commanded by God to stay away from it in the first place in Jeremiah 10:2-4 which reads:

2. Thus says the LORD, "Do not learn the way of the nations, And do not be terrified by the signs of the heavens Although the nations are terrified by them;

3. For the customs of the peoples are delusion; Because it is wood cut from the forest, The work of the hands of a craftsman with a cutting tool.

4. They decorate it with silver and with gold; They fasten it with nails and with hammers so that it will not totter."


The King James Version reads: "Thus saith the Lord, Learn not the way of the heathen.... For the customs of the people are vain: for one cutteth a tree out of the forest, the work of the hands of the workman, with the axe. They deck it with silver and with gold; they fasten it with nails and with hammers, that it move not."

Now many will argue that this is not a pagan symbol but is now a Christian symbol, but that is what Aaron thought as he created a Golden Calf. Did not God rise up and destroy them for trying to use a Pagan image to honor him. Just a thought.

There are many kinds of celebrations that happen around the time of the winter solstice - an observable, measurable, physical astronomical event. What are "insultingly" called "pagan" people developed and defined astronomy as a science by observation and recording of celestial events - noting that they recurred on a regular, predictable schedule - and chose to celebrate certain of those times [esp the solstices and equinoxes] with elaborate pageants and ceremonies.
And then RELIGION - of all varieties - co-opted those already established and popular "pagan" celebrations and redefined that particular astronomical date and time as a "religiously" meaningful.
An evergreen tree symbol, tradition, and celebration of Christ's birth developed in Northern Europe - far, far away from the actual geographic area. There were no pine trees in Nazareth or Bethlehem!!
